Ghana forward Kevin Prince Boateng has bemoaned Jerome Boateng's inability to play for Bayern Munich in their Eintracht Frankfurt engage the Bavarian giants in the German Cup final on Saturday.
The German defender picked up an injury when Bayern Munich suffered a 2-1 home defeat against Real Madrid in the first leg of their UEFA Champions League semi-finals.
"It's a sad story for the Boateng family, and I wrote to him right after the injury," said his big brother, who enjoys Jérôme's dilemma in a purely athletic way.
"Bayern are a bit weaker without him, he is one of the best, maybe even the best center-back in the world," praised Boateng.
The Eagles will encounter Bayern Munich, who have been crowned the champions of the Bundesliga, in the 2017/18 DFB Pokal final at the Allianz Arena..
